AABIP/AIPPD Mid-Year Advanced Therapeutic Bronchoscopy and Thoracoscopy Course for IP FellowsJoin us February 9-10, 2024 at the University of Maryland for the AABIP & AIPPD first annual Mid-Year Advanced Therapeutic Bronchoscopy and Thoracoscopy Course for IP Fellows. This two-day, mid-year program, is focused on advanced rigid bronchoscopy (airway stenting, ablation-assisted rigid debulking) and thoracoscopy in cadaveric models. The main purpose is to coach the IP fellows on techniques/tools that might not be available in their training institutions and expose them to different styles of performing these procedures from a diverse and world class faculty.
The course will consist of an online didactic component as pre-work followed by problem-based learning and skills-based training utilizing hands-on cadaveric and simulation training. Such introductory training to procedures is a widely accepted method of improving patient safety in procedurally oriented training programs. Additionally, since this course is aimed at bringing together the IP fellows from all programs in the United States, this will provide a forum for networking and academic collaboration that will further advance the field of Interventional Pulmonology.
